Hot Fiesta Slot Review
Pragmatic Play brings the vibrant energy of a Mexican celebration to the reels with Hot Fiesta, a high-volatility slot that combines festive theming with some genuinely interesting mechanics. Released in April 2021, this 5×3 grid delivers a 96.56% RTP alongside sticky roaming wild symbols that can deliver substantial wins during the bonus round. While the base game can feel repetitive for some, the free spins feature with its 5,000x maximum win potential offers the main draw for players seeking bigger payouts.

Base Game & Features
Hot Fiesta’s base game plays out on a fixed 5×3 grid with 25 paylines that you can’t adjust. The game features 11 regular pay symbols including 10-Ace card royals for the lower pays, and more thematic symbols such as cocktails, maracas, guitars, accordions, and the Señorita and Señor characters representing the premium symbols. The purple piñata wild can land on any reel and comes with random multipliers of 2x, 3x, or 5x, adding a layer of excitement to winning combinations when it appears.
The gameplay itself is straightforward but can feel quite samey during extended base game sessions. You’re essentially chasing those wild symbols to land on paylines and boost your winnings with their multiplier values. Pragmatic Play has designed the base game mechanics to be relatively simple–there aren’t complex modifiers or triggers beyond the scatter requirement needed to reach the bonus round. This simplicity works both ways: it’s easy to understand, but some players find it lacks the variety they’d prefer in a modern slot.

Hot Fiesta Free Spins
Where Hot Fiesta truly comes alive is in the bonus round. Landing three fireworks scatter symbols specifically on reels 1, 3, and 5 triggers the feature, awarding 3x your bet as an immediate payout before entering the free spins bonus. An exploding piñata then reveals how many spins you’ve earned–anywhere from 9 to 27 free spins depending on the randomised reveal.
The restriction to reels 1, 3, and 5 does dampen the frequency of free spins triggering compared to games where scatters can land anywhere. This is a deliberate design choice by Pragmatic Play, and it reinforces that these bonus rounds are meant to be special events rather than regular occurrences–especially on base RTP without the Ante Bet feature active.
Sticky Roaming Wilds During Free Spins
The free spins mode is where the sticky roaming wild feature elevates the gameplay significantly. During the bonus round, wild symbols land with their random multipliers (2x, 3x, or 5x) and remain on the reels for the entire duration of the feature. These aren’t sticky in the traditional sense where they stay in the same position–they roam to new positions on each spin, creating the potential for multiple wilds accumulating across the reels as the spins progress. This mechanic can lead to some genuinely satisfying win combinations, particularly if you land several high-multiplier wilds before the feature concludes.
Ante Bet Feature
Hot Fiesta offers an Ante Bet option as an alternative to traditional bonus buys. When activated, Ante Bet increases your spin cost by 40% but doubles your chances of landing the three scatter combination needed to trigger free spins. The trade-off isn’t particularly severe–activating Ante Bet reduces your RTP from 96.56% to 96.53%, a negligible 0.03 percentage point decrease. For players who find the base game tedious and want more frequent access to the bonus feature, Ante Bet provides a practical middle ground between grinding the base game and simply buying the feature outright.

Our Honest Verdict
Rating: 6.5/10
Hot Fiesta is a solidly competent slot from Pragmatic Play that doesn’t quite reach the heights of the developer’s best work. The festive Mexican theme is executed with pleasant visuals–brightly painted buildings, vibrant colours, and an upbeat mariachi soundtrack create an authentic celebratory atmosphere. However, the theme itself isn’t particularly original, leaning into familiar tropes rather than offering anything surprising or deeply immersive.
The game mechanics are effective but unremarkable. The sticky roaming wilds during free spins step things up considerably, delivering satisfying wins when the feature triggers. However, the base game between bonuses can feel like you’re chasing multiplier wilds through repetitive spins with limited variety. The 5,000x maximum win potential is respectable and occasionally achievable, though the high volatility means these wins won’t arrive with any regularity.
Community ratings hover around 3.9 out of 5 stars, reflecting a mixed reception. Players acknowledge the decent features and functional design, but describe the overall experience as unremarkable and somewhat lacking in passion compared to similar-themed slots from Pragmatic Play or competitors. If you’re comparing Hot Fiesta to The Dog House, another Pragmatic title with similar mechanics, The Dog House generally edges ahead with its higher maximum win potential (6,000x+) and more compelling presentation.
Hot Fiesta works best for players specifically seeking a high-volatility game with straightforward mechanics and reasonable win potential. It’s not particularly suited for casual players chasing frequent smaller wins–the infrequent triggering of bonus features combined with the tedious base game stretches between bonuses would likely frustrate them. If you embrace the volatility and enjoy sticky wild mechanics, you’ll find enough enjoyment here to justify some spins. Just don’t expect this to be a standout title in your rotation.
